Jaw Clicking Pain - Causes and Cures

Your jaw is clicking when your eating, it hurts to chew and open your mouth wide. Jaw clicking pain is a symptom of a common condition called TMJ. Your definitely not alone, about 30% of the population have symptoms of TMJ and most dentists and therapists are treating it poorly, dismissing it as stress related.
